Structural and Molecular Characterization of the Hemagglutinin from the Fifth Epidemic Wave A(H7N9) Influenza Viruses.

J. Virol.. 2018-05; 
YangHua,CarneyPaul J,ChangJessie C,GuoZhu,StevensJ

摘要

The avian influenza A(H7N9) virus continues to cause human infections in China and is a major ongoing public health concern. Five epidemic waves of A(H7N9) infection have occurred since 2013, and the recent fifth epidemic wave saw the emergence of two distinct lineages with elevated numbers of human infection cases and broader geographic distribution of viral diseases compared to the first four epidemic waves. Moreover, highly pathogenic avian influenza (HPAI) A(H7N9) viruses were also isolated during the fifth epidemic wave.
